
(Patria) - Iran does not want a ceasefire that would allow its adversaries to rearm and launch a new attack, said Iran's Deputy Foreign Minister for Political Affairs, Majid Takht Ravanchi. He stated his position during a meeting with foreign ambassadors and heads of international organizations in Tehran, commenting on the upcoming Iran-US talks in Islamabad, the Mehr news agency reports.
Ravanchi confirmed that it was agreed that Iran's 10-point plan would serve as the basis for negotiations. "The Islamic Republic of Iran always welcomes diplomacy and dialogue, but not dialogue based on false information aimed at deception and laying the groundwork for renewed military aggression against Iran," he said.
"We do not want a ceasefire that would allow the aggressor enemy to rearm and attack again. We have clearly told our friends that this situation will not be repeated without guarantees," Ravanchi concluded.
